Context Readings

The Lord Alone Is God

34 Either, whether God assayed to go and take him a people from among nations, through temptations and signs and wonders and through war and with a mighty hand and a stretched-out arm and with mighty terrible sights, according unto all that the LORD your God did unto you in Egypt before your eyes. 35 Unto thee it was showed, that thou mightest know how that the LORD he is God and that there is none but he. 36 Out of heaven he made thee hear his voice to nurture thee, and upon earth he showed thee his great fire, and thou heardest his words out of the fire.
